hh3cNATPoolRowStatus
HH3C-NAT-MIB ·
.1.3.6.1.4.1.25506.2.18.2.1.1.6
Object
Only support 'destroy' and 'createAndGo'. If hh3cNATPoolIdx, hh3cNATPoolStartIpAddr and hh3cNATPoolEndIpAddr were provided correctly, its value is changed 'active'.
